Trouble Opening or Closing Your Mouth
Experiencing trouble opening or closing your mouth is a clear indicator that you ought to get in touch with a dental cosmetic surgeon immediately. This symptom can be an indication of different underlying dental health issues that call for timely focus.
Right here are 5 possible causes for your difficulty in opening or closing your mouth:
-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Problem: TMJ problem affects the joint that links your jawbone to your skull. It can cause discomfort and tightness, making it difficult to move your jaw.
- Lockjaw: Lockjaw, additionally referred to as trismus, is a condition where the jaw muscles spasm and protect against regular mouth opening.
- Dental Cancer Cells: Difficulty in mouth movement can be a very early indicator of oral cancer cells. It's crucial to get it inspected by a dental specialist.
- Infection: An infection in the mouth or salivary glands can trigger swelling and problem in mouth motion.
- Injury: Injury to the jaw or face can lead to problems with jaw activity.
If you experience difficulty opening up or closing your mouth, don't delay looking for expert help from an oral specialist.

Loose or Shifting Teeth
If you see your teeth coming to be loosened or shifting, it's crucial to speak with an oral doctor instantly. This could be a sign of a major oral issue that calls for punctual interest. Below are some reasons why loosened or shifting teeth should not be disregarded:
- Trauma or injury: Teeth can become loosened as a result of a blow to the mouth or face. An oral surgeon can evaluate the damages and offer proper treatment.
- Periodontal condition: Advanced gum tissue disease can trigger the supporting structures of the teeth to weaken, resulting in tooth wheelchair. A dental doctor can assess the degree of the disease and advise treatment options.
- Dental caries: Extreme degeneration can weaken the stability of the tooth, causing it to end up being loosened. A dental cosmetic surgeon can determine the best course of action.
- Bite issues: Misaligned teeth or an improper bite can trigger teeth to change or end up being loosened. An oral cosmetic surgeon can resolve these issues and protect against further damage.
- Bone loss: In some cases, bone loss in the jaw can trigger teeth to become loosened. A dental specialist can assess the situation and give suitable treatment to restore security.
Clicking or Standing Out Jaw Joint
Do you experience a clicking or popping experience in your jaw joint? This could be an indication that you need to seek advice from a dental specialist instantly.
Clicking or appearing the jaw joint, likewise called the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can suggest a trouble with the joint's alignment or feature. It might be triggered by problems such as TMJ condition, joint inflammation, or a displaced disc in the joint.
This clicking or standing out can cause pain, pain, and difficulty in opening or closing your mouth. If left untreated, it can aggravate and affect your day-to-day live.
As a result, it's important to seek the knowledge of a dental specialist that can identify the underlying reason and supply suitable therapy choices to ease your symptoms and stop more problems.
